Compliance Monitoring Automation: Best Practices for RIAs
To effectively navigate the evolving regulatory landscape, Registered Investment Advisors (RIAs) must prioritize compliance monitoring automation. Adopting this technology isn't just about minimizing workload; it's about improving risk management and proving a commitment to compliance . Here are some key best practices:
- Define a clear roadmap for your automation project, identifying specific compliance areas to target, such as trade monitoring, marketing review, and client protection.
- Integrate your automation solution with existing systems—portfolio management software , CRM systems , and communication platforms—to ensure a unified data flow.
- Frequently validate the accuracy and effectiveness of automated processes, conducting periodic audits and reviewing results against established policies and procedures.
- Focus employee development on the new automated processes , ensuring they grasp its capabilities and limitations.
- Document all automation decisions, parameters, and monitoring results to provide a thorough audit trail for regulators.
